Job Description
We are seeking a dedicated Virtual Website Accessibility Tester to join our growing team. This is a unique opportunity for individuals with personal screen reader experience to transition their expertise into a professional role. You will play a crucial part in evaluating websites and web applications for accessibility compliance, primarily using various screen readers and other assistive technologies. Full training on accessibility standards (WCAG) and professional testing methodologies will be provided. Key Responsibilities
- Conduct comprehensive accessibility testing of websites and web applications using screen readers (e.g., NVDA, JAWS, VoiceOver) and other assistive technologies.
- Identify, document, and report accessibility issues and violations based on WCAG (Web Content Accessibility Guidelines) standards.
- Collaborate with development and design teams to provide clear, actionable feedback for remediation.
